Media and Communication

Queensland University of Technology

This course is centred on the distribution of creative content including an emphasis on new media, television, radio, print, the internet, mobile technologies, movies, advertising, public relations and music. It also encompasses media research and media policy so you will understand how the media works, its impacts on society, and the issues which shape public debate about the media.

About Media Studies & Mass Media

Media Studies degrees teach students about media channels, focusing on mass-media and its history, content, and social impact. Students learn about traditional (radio, television) and modern mass-media (social networks, vlogs). Typical Media Studies include classes on Ethics and Journalism, Legal Issues in Communication, and Visual Culture. Graduates work as media planners, PR officers, or social media managers.
